dc.description.abstract | The time like structure of the five-dimensional Schwarzschild and Reissner-Nordstrom anti-de Sitter black holes is studied in detail. Different kinds of motion are allowed and studied by using an adequate effective potential. Then, by solving the corresponding equations of motion, several trajectories and orbits are described in terms of Weierstra ss elliptic functions and elementary functions for neutral particles. | |
